Intel ได้ทำการแก้ไขปัญหาใน Linux Kernel หลังจากที่ Linus Torvalds ผู้พัฒนาหลักของ Linux แสดงความไม่พอใจอย่างรุนแรงเกี่ยวกับการเปลี่ยนแปลงโค้ดที่ส่งผลกระทบต่อกระบวนการคอมไพล์ โดยปัญหานี้เกี่ยวข้องกับ Direct Rendering Manager (DRM) สำหรับ Intel Xe Graphics Driver ซึ่งมีการเพิ่มไฟล์ทดสอบที่สร้างปัญหาให้กับกระบวนการสร้างเคอร์เนล
HDRTest Files สร้างปัญหาต่อกระบวนการคอมไพล์
- Torvalds ชี้ให้เห็นว่าไฟล์ hdrtest ไม่ควรอยู่ในการคอมไพล์หลัก เพราะทำให้ระบบ ทำงานช้าลงและสร้างไฟล์ขยะในไดเรกทอรี
- ไฟล์เหล่านี้ทำให้คำสั่ง git status แจ้งเตือนว่าไฟล์ไม่ได้ถูก ignore และส่งผลให้ผู้ใช้พบไฟล์ที่ไม่จำเป็นในระบบ
ปฏิกิริยาจาก Intel
- Jani Nikula วิศวกร Linux ของ Intel ตอบโต้ด้วยการบอกว่า จะ "ซ่อนไฟล์ขยะเหล่านี้" ไว้ในไดเรกทอรีย่อย และเพิ่มตัวเลือก Kconfig เพื่อควบคุมการตรวจสอบโค้ด
- การแก้ไขนี้ช่วยให้โค้ดทำงานเร็วขึ้นและลดปัญหาการรบกวนของไฟล์ที่ไม่จำเป็น
Torvalds ยืนยันว่าไฟล์ HDRTest ควรถูกกำจัดออกไป
- แม้ว่า Intel จะเสนอทางออกในการซ่อนไฟล์เหล่านี้ Torvalds ยืนยันว่าควรลบออกไปเลย
- เขาแนะนำให้ Intel แยกการทดสอบเหล่านี้เป็น make drm-hdrtest เพื่อให้สามารถรันได้แยกจากการคอมไพล์หลัก
การปรับปรุงโค้ดสำหรับ Linux Kernel 6.15
- การเปลี่ยนแปลงนี้จะถูกบรรจุใน Linux Kernel 6.15 ซึ่งจะช่วยให้การคอมไพล์ทำงานได้เร็วขึ้นและไม่มีไฟล์ขยะที่รบกวนระบบ
https://www.neowin.net/news/intel-gives-linus-torvalds-funny-taste-of-his-own-language-to-hide-disgusting-broken-turds/
HDRTest Files สร้างปัญหาต่อกระบวนการคอมไพล์
- Torvalds ชี้ให้เห็นว่าไฟล์ hdrtest ไม่ควรอยู่ในการคอมไพล์หลัก เพราะทำให้ระบบ ทำงานช้าลงและสร้างไฟล์ขยะในไดเรกทอรี
- ไฟล์เหล่านี้ทำให้คำสั่ง git status แจ้งเตือนว่าไฟล์ไม่ได้ถูก ignore และส่งผลให้ผู้ใช้พบไฟล์ที่ไม่จำเป็นในระบบ
ปฏิกิริยาจาก Intel
- Jani Nikula วิศวกร Linux ของ Intel ตอบโต้ด้วยการบอกว่า จะ "ซ่อนไฟล์ขยะเหล่านี้" ไว้ในไดเรกทอรีย่อย และเพิ่มตัวเลือก Kconfig เพื่อควบคุมการตรวจสอบโค้ด
- การแก้ไขนี้ช่วยให้โค้ดทำงานเร็วขึ้นและลดปัญหาการรบกวนของไฟล์ที่ไม่จำเป็น
Torvalds ยืนยันว่าไฟล์ HDRTest ควรถูกกำจัดออกไป
- แม้ว่า Intel จะเสนอทางออกในการซ่อนไฟล์เหล่านี้ Torvalds ยืนยันว่าควรลบออกไปเลย
- เขาแนะนำให้ Intel แยกการทดสอบเหล่านี้เป็น make drm-hdrtest เพื่อให้สามารถรันได้แยกจากการคอมไพล์หลัก
การปรับปรุงโค้ดสำหรับ Linux Kernel 6.15
- การเปลี่ยนแปลงนี้จะถูกบรรจุใน Linux Kernel 6.15 ซึ่งจะช่วยให้การคอมไพล์ทำงานได้เร็วขึ้นและไม่มีไฟล์ขยะที่รบกวนระบบ
https://www.neowin.net/news/intel-gives-linus-torvalds-funny-taste-of-his-own-language-to-hide-disgusting-broken-turds/
Intel ได้ทำการแก้ไขปัญหาใน Linux Kernel หลังจากที่ Linus Torvalds ผู้พัฒนาหลักของ Linux แสดงความไม่พอใจอย่างรุนแรงเกี่ยวกับการเปลี่ยนแปลงโค้ดที่ส่งผลกระทบต่อกระบวนการคอมไพล์ โดยปัญหานี้เกี่ยวข้องกับ Direct Rendering Manager (DRM) สำหรับ Intel Xe Graphics Driver ซึ่งมีการเพิ่มไฟล์ทดสอบที่สร้างปัญหาให้กับกระบวนการสร้างเคอร์เนล
HDRTest Files สร้างปัญหาต่อกระบวนการคอมไพล์
- Torvalds ชี้ให้เห็นว่าไฟล์ hdrtest ไม่ควรอยู่ในการคอมไพล์หลัก เพราะทำให้ระบบ ทำงานช้าลงและสร้างไฟล์ขยะในไดเรกทอรี
- ไฟล์เหล่านี้ทำให้คำสั่ง git status แจ้งเตือนว่าไฟล์ไม่ได้ถูก ignore และส่งผลให้ผู้ใช้พบไฟล์ที่ไม่จำเป็นในระบบ
ปฏิกิริยาจาก Intel
- Jani Nikula วิศวกร Linux ของ Intel ตอบโต้ด้วยการบอกว่า จะ "ซ่อนไฟล์ขยะเหล่านี้" ไว้ในไดเรกทอรีย่อย และเพิ่มตัวเลือก Kconfig เพื่อควบคุมการตรวจสอบโค้ด
- การแก้ไขนี้ช่วยให้โค้ดทำงานเร็วขึ้นและลดปัญหาการรบกวนของไฟล์ที่ไม่จำเป็น
Torvalds ยืนยันว่าไฟล์ HDRTest ควรถูกกำจัดออกไป
- แม้ว่า Intel จะเสนอทางออกในการซ่อนไฟล์เหล่านี้ Torvalds ยืนยันว่าควรลบออกไปเลย
- เขาแนะนำให้ Intel แยกการทดสอบเหล่านี้เป็น make drm-hdrtest เพื่อให้สามารถรันได้แยกจากการคอมไพล์หลัก
การปรับปรุงโค้ดสำหรับ Linux Kernel 6.15
- การเปลี่ยนแปลงนี้จะถูกบรรจุใน Linux Kernel 6.15 ซึ่งจะช่วยให้การคอมไพล์ทำงานได้เร็วขึ้นและไม่มีไฟล์ขยะที่รบกวนระบบ
https://www.neowin.net/news/intel-gives-linus-torvalds-funny-taste-of-his-own-language-to-hide-disgusting-broken-turds/
0 Comments
0 Shares
76 Views
0 Reviews